The PlateWriter™ 2400 is an addition to Glunz & Jensen’s acclaimed iCtP range of Computer-to-Plate systems, which produces press-ready aluminum plates without the use of chemical processing.
The PlateWriter™ 2400’s inkjet Computer-to-Plate system uses an innovative technology that sets new standards in the cost, flexibility and speed of offset printing for small to medium format printers.
Key Benefits:
- * Affordability – Significantly lower investment than the cost of current, laser based plate imaging systems
- * Ease-of-use – Operates in daylight conditions; no pressroom changes are required to plate clamping or press chemistries
- * Reduces plate production costs – The cost per plate is less than the cost of conventional metal platemaking methods
- * Environmentally friendly – No disposal of processing chemicals into the waste stream eliminating disposal costs
- * High quality output – FM or stochastic screening capable of emulating 175 conventional line screening
- * Flexibility – Any plate size in 2- or 4-up formats, wide range of thicknesses from .005” to .12”
